- What is Ryan Specialty Holdings's D&A?
- Ryan Specialty Holdings (RYAN) reported D&A of $4.06M in Q1 2026.
- How has Ryan Specialty Holdings's D&A changed year-over-year?
- Ryan Specialty Holdings's D&A increased by 53.9% year-over-year, from $2.64M to $4.06M.
- What is the long-term trend for Ryan Specialty Holdings's D&A?
- Over 4 years (2021 to 2025), Ryan Specialty Holdings's D&A has grown at a 28.5%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$4.81M to $13.09M.
- What does D&A mean?
- Non-cash expense representing the systematic allocation of tangible asset costs (depreciation) and intangible asset costs (amortization) over their useful lives.
